Stovetop "Unstuffed" Bell Peppers


Here's Paula's latest shortcut recipe for busy moms:


"I grew up on stuffed bell peppers and my children have always loved them, but they are a bit time consuming. I have to admit, I was feeling lazy the other night and took a few shortcuts but the results were fantastic!''

1 lb. ground beef or turkey
2-3 small bell peppers coarsely chopped
1 can of spaghetti sauce (I use Hunt's)
1 8 oz can of tomato sauce
1-2 cups of instant rice
1 cup of mozzarella cheese
Seasonings to taste (I season my ground meat with onions, garlic powder, Italian seasoning and salt and pepper)

Brown and season ground meat in pot, drain (or brown in skillet and transfer to pot that you would normally cook your spaghetti sauce in)
Add Spaghetti Sauce and bell peppers
Bring to a boil
Reduce heat to medium
Add tomato sauce and cook for 2-3 minutes
Add instant rice
Cover and cook for 10-15 minutes
Reduce heat to low
Stir in Cheese and serve

We also like to add Parmesan cheese to ours! Enjoy!
